Heroin Detoxification and Suboxone Pharmaceutical Profits
Heroin addiction rates are rising in Southern California, leading to a surge in patients seeking detoxification at psychiatric hospitals. Doctors are increasingly prescribing Suboxone, a sublingual narcotic manufactured by Reckitt Benckiser, which requires specialized licensing to distribute and can lead to years of dependency.
